Transmission issue

Hey Guys.

I currently own a 2010 e90 6speed and over The past couple of weeks i have been heading this weird noise coming out of The transmission when the car is not in gear. When in neutral it males this clunky sound as with the flywheel is clipping another piece if mental. Anyway, I wad Also hearing a thumping sound coming from the front right tire so I decided to bring the car in to the local dealer. It turns out that they are now relacing my entire transmission WTF! Is that the procedure? Have any of you experienced this issue and have had their tranny replaced? I am a bit confused and highly doubt if that will fix the thumping noise it the front right tire. Any thoughts are welcome. Thanks
